The majority of the cleaning company operators we consulted with used personal cost savings to begin their organizations, then reinvested their early earnings to money development - office cleaning services near me. If you require to purchase devices, you need to be able to find funding, particularly if you can show that you have actually put some of your own money into the company.
Some suggestions: Do a comprehensive stock of your properties. Individuals generally have more properties than they instantly understand. This could include cost savings accounts, equity in realty, pension, lorries, leisure equipment, collections and other investments. You might choose to sell properties for money or utilize them as collateral for a loan.
Lots of a successful service has actually been started with charge card. The next rational step after collecting your own resources is to approach good friends and family members who believe in you and wish to help you be successful. Beware with these arrangements; no matter how close you are, present yourself expertly, put whatever in composing, and be sure the individuals you approach can pay for to take the threat of investing in your business.
Using the "strength in numbers" concept, look around for somebody who might wish to team up with you in your endeavor. You may select somebody who has funds and wishes to work side-by-side with you in business. Or you might discover someone who has money to invest but no interest in doing the real work.
Benefit from the abundance of regional, state and federal programs designed to support small companies. Make your very first stop the U.S. Small Company Administration; then investigate numerous other programs. Ladies, minorities and veterans must inspect out specific niche financing possibilities created to assist these groups enter service. Numerous municipalities have regulations that restrict the nature and volume of business activities that can occur in property areas.
Others might permit such enterprises however location restrictions regarding concerns such as signs, traffic, staff members, commercially marked automobiles and noise. Prior to you use for your service license, find out what ordinances govern homebased organizations; you may need to adjust your plan to be in compliance. In reality, your automobiles are basically your company on wheels. They need to be thoroughly picked and well-kept to properly serve and represent you. For a house maid service, an economy car or station wagon must suffice. You need enough room to store devices and products, and to transfer your cleaning teams, but you normally won't be hauling around pieces of devices big enough to need a van or little truck.
If you supply the vehicles, paint your company's name, logo design and phone number on them. This advertises your business all over town. If your employees use their own cars and trucks-- which is especially common with house maid services-- ask for proof that they have sufficient insurance coverage to cover them in case of a mishap.
The kind of vehicles you'll require for a janitorial service depends on the size and type of devices you utilize along with the size and number of your crews. An economy car or station wagon could work if you're doing relatively light cleaning in smaller sized workplaces, but for a lot of janitorial services, you're more likely to need a truck or van.
A great utilized truck will cost about $10,000, while a new one will range from $18,000 up. Prices can be laborious and time-consuming, especially if you don't have a knack for crunching numbers.
If your quote is too low, you'll either rob yourself of some profit or be forced to decrease the quality of your work to satisfy the rate. If you estimate too expensive, you may lose the contract completely, specifically if you're in a competitive bidding scenario. Remember, in lots of cleaning scenarios, you may be competing against the consumer himself; if your quote is high, she or he might believe, "For that much money, I can just do this myself."During the preliminary days of your operation, you ought to return and look at the actual costs of every task when it's finished to see how close your quote was to truth. commercial floor cleaning services.

Openly ask what you can do to ensure timely payment; that might include confirming the right billing address and discovering what paperwork may be needed to help the customer determine the credibility of the invoice. Keep in mind that lots of large companies pay specific types of billings on certain days of the month; learn if your clients do that, and arrange your invoices to show up in time for the next payment cycle.
Terms consist of the date the billing is due, any discount rate for early payment and additional charges for late payment. It's also a great concept to specifically specify the date the billing ends up being past due to prevent any possible misconception. If you're going to charge a charge for late payment, make certain your billing states that it's a late payment or rebilling charge, not a finance charge.

Though the overall market for cleaning services is tremendous, you should decide on the particular niche you will target.
If you're starting a maid service, you wish to have the ability to arrange cleanings in a way that keeps your travel time to a minimum. The same uses to carpet cleaners. Janitorial teams that must move from developing to structure have a comparable issue. After you've recognized what you wish to do and where you 'd like to do it, research the demographics of the area to be sure it consists of an adequate number of possible clients.
If it does not, you'll need to reevaluate how you have actually specified your niche or the geographical location. Part of your market analysis includes your costs to serve that market. A densely inhabited market permits you to serve a higher number of consumers because your travel time is very little, but it likewise indicates you'll be taking in more materials.
